
Introduction
This manual contains information designed to familiarize you with the features and functions of
the DI-159 PLC data acquisition starter kit.
The DI-159 PLC provides a USB port interface and can be used under any operating system
that can run a terminal emulator and hook a COM port. A connected terminal emulator pro-
vides direct access to the DI-159 PLC’s embedded BASIC programming environment and,
depending upon the emulator, the ability to save and load an unlimited number of programs
beyond the DI-159 PLC’s built-in flash memory limit of three. Emulators that are available
online for free are Terminator and Konsole (Linux), iTerm2 (OS X), and PuTTY and Ter-
aTerm (Windows).
DATAQ has provided a Windows terminal emulator program to use with all DATAQ Instru-
ments PLC devices.
Features
The DI-159 PLC (programmable logic controller) data acquisition instrument is a portable con-
trol module that communicates through your computer's USB port. Power is derived from the
interface port so no external power is required while the instrument remains tethered to a PC.
An optional power supply (part number 101085) powers the instrument in a stand-alone con-
figuration. Features include:
lEmbedded BASIC (StickOS) programming environment for control applications.
l8 fixed differential analog inputs protected to ±150V (transient); ±10V full scale meas-
urement range (output is in millivolts).
l4 digital inputs protected to ±30V; TTL threshold levels.
l4 digital outputs protected to ±30V; 0.5A sink current max.
l1 general-purpose push-button.
l2 general-purpose LEDs.
l1 heartbeat LED for easy indication of system activity.
Analog Inputs
The DI-159 features eight differential analog inputs located on two sixteen-position screw ter-
minal blocks for easy connection and operation (other terminals used for digital I/O). Connect
the DI-159 PLC to any pre-amplified signal in the typical range of ±5 to ±10VFS. Please note:
The DI-159 does not support analog outputs.
3